Plants Vs Zombies 2 Teaser Trailer


This is great news! PvZ is a fantastic game and a sequel (as the video shows) has been heavily requested for a long time now. It seems Popcap have finally caved!

What do you think of the teaser? Are you a fan of Plants vs Zombies? Let us know in the comments below and tell us more in our forums!